What is Generative Grammar, Anyway?

So, what exactly is generative grammar? In a nutshell, it's a linguistic theory that seeks to describe the underlying rules that allow us to generate and understand all the grammatical sentences of a language. Think of it as a blueprint for language. Instead of just listing sentences, generative grammar tries to explain how we can create new sentences that we've never heard before. The central idea is that our brains have an innate capacity for language, and generative grammar attempts to model this capacity. This model is often expressed as a set of formal rules. These rules are not just a collection of dos and don'ts; they're the building blocks that allow us to generate all of the grammatical sentences and to identify when something isn’t grammatical. It's like a mathematical formula for language. Developed primarily by Noam Chomsky, it revolutionized the way we study language, shifting the focus from simply describing language to understanding the underlying cognitive processes involved. Generative grammar isn't just about the structure of sentences; it's about the cognitive structures in our brains that allow us to use language. It tries to explain how people know the rules of grammar, even if they can't consciously state them. This is the beauty of it: understanding the system, rather than just the parts.

The Core Principles: Syntax, Semantics, and More!

Alright, let's get into the nitty-gritty of generative grammar and explore the key principles. It's not just about memorizing rules, it's about seeing how they work together to create language! First up, we have syntax, which is essentially the set of rules that govern how words are combined to form phrases and sentences. It's like the architecture of a sentence. This includes things like word order, phrase structure, and grammatical relationships. For example, knowing that in English, we generally say ā€œthe blue carā€ and not ā€œblue the carā€ is part of understanding syntax. Then there's semantics, which is the study of meaning. How do words and sentences convey meaning? What do the words represent? Understanding semantics involves understanding the meanings of words, phrases, and sentences and how they relate to each other. For instance, knowing the difference between ā€œthe dog bit the manā€ and ā€œthe man bit the dogā€ is a key aspect of semantics. And don't forget morphology, which is the study of word formation. It explores how words are formed from smaller units of meaning called morphemes (like prefixes, suffixes, and root words). It’s the building blocks of words. For example, understanding that the word ā€œunbreakableā€ is made up of ā€œun-ā€ + ā€œbreakā€ + ā€œ-ableā€ is about morphology.

Generative grammar also relies heavily on the concept of phrase structure rules, which describe how phrases are built. These rules dictate the hierarchical structure of sentences, showing how words group together to form larger units like noun phrases (NP) and verb phrases (VP). Think of it like a tree diagram where the sentence branches into phrases, then into words. Transformational grammar, a key aspect of the generative perspective, introduced the idea that sentences have multiple levels of structure, including deep structure and surface structure. Deep structure represents the underlying meaning of a sentence, while surface structure is the actual form of the sentence we speak or write.
